Plumas County paving licensure at a glance
California licenses contractors by classification and CSLB publishes one on every record, so supply can be counted exactly: 8 active C-12 earthwork and paving licenses in Plumas County, 5 of them registered in Greenville. CSLB also publishes a real original issue date, which Washington's registry does not, so tenure is measurable here: the median Greenville license has been held 6 years, and the longest-standing one dates to 2006. 4 of Greenville's 5 licenses (80.0%) carry current workers' compensation cover in CSLB's file. That is employee injury cover, not liability insurance, and a blank usually means an owner-operator with no employees - lawful, and not a mark against anyone. The contractor bond is not a signal here: 8 of the county's 8 licenses carry the same $25,000 bond California sets by statute. 1 county license reaches its expiration date within the next 90 days. Does California license paving contractors?
Yes. California licenses contractors by classification, and C-12 is the CSLB classification that authorises this work. 5 active C-12 earthwork and paving licenses are registered in Greenville and 8 across Plumas County, the longest-standing issued in 2006. Only CLEAR, unexpired licenses appear here.
How do I check a paving contractor's license in California?
Every listing above shows its CSLB license number. CSLB cannot link straight to a record, so open its license lookup and type the number in: it shows status, expiration, the contractor bond and workers' compensation cover, which 4 of Greenville's 5 currently carry. 1 Plumas County license expires within 90 days.
